HeartMath Coherence Breathing

Since ancient times, proper breathing has been associated with physical and mental health. Science has upheld the connection between controlled breathing and correct functioning of the parasympathetic nervous system. Put simply, learning to control breathing can help us relax body and mind. Breathing can soothing our irregular physical and mental reactions to stress. In conjunction with other therapies, HeartMath Coherence Breathing can help us get control of body and mind and come to a more tranquil, open state. This in turn helps us focus on positive change.

How Heartmath Coherence Breathing Works

HeartMath Coherence Breathing is a practice which can be learned to assist with calming the nervous system. Breathing guides heart rate and heart rate variability (the changes in heart rate). Heartmath involves paying attention to your breath, where you hold muscle tension, your posture, and other indicators of either stressed or calm states. We can use the Heartmath biofeedback system to get real-time feedback to learn effective methods for calming you can take with you anywhere.  Heartmath can be used with all ages, even the very young.
